Understanding L-Lysine Sulfate in the Global Feed Industry
L-Lysine Sulfate is an essential amino acid feed additive widely used in livestock nutrition to improve animal growth performance and optimize protein utilization. It plays a critical role in modern feed formulations where balanced amino acid profiles are necessary for efficient production.
According to the Food and Agriculture Organization (FAO), amino acid supplementation has become increasingly important as livestock producers seek to improve feed conversion efficiency while reducing environmental impacts associated with excess protein consumption.
Role in Animal Nutrition
L-Lysine Sulfate is primarily incorporated into feed for poultry, swine, aquaculture, and other livestock sectors. As lysine is often the first limiting amino acid in cereal-based diets, supplementation helps support healthy growth and muscle development.
Technical information published by the National Research Council (NRC) highlights the importance of lysine in animal nutrition programs, particularly in intensive livestock production systems where feed efficiency directly affects profitability.

Sustainability and Feed Optimization
Modern feed manufacturers increasingly use amino acid supplementation to reduce crude protein levels while maintaining animal performance. This approach supports sustainability goals by lowering nitrogen emissions from livestock operations.
Research published through agricultural and animal science institutions demonstrates that optimized amino acid nutrition can contribute to more efficient resource utilization throughout the livestock value chain.
